Sean Strickland Withdraws from UFC Fight Night 212 Headliner vs. Jared Cannonier

A finger infection has forced Sean Strickland to withdraw from the UFC Fight Night 212 main event against Jared Cannonier on Oct. 15.

UFC president Dana White confirmed Strickland’s exit from the card following the Contender Series on Tuesday night while adding that the promoiton will not seek a replacement opponent for Cannonier. UFC Fight Night 212 takes place at the UFC Apex in Las Vegas and also includes a women’s flyweight clash between Viviane Araujo and Alexa Grasso as well as a men’s 125-pound tilt pitting Askar Askarov against Brandon Royval.

Strickland had a bid for title contention shot down at UFC 276, as he suffered a first-round KO defeat to former Glory Kickboxing champ Alex Pereira in his most recent Octagon appearance. That defeat snapped a six-bout winning streak for the 31-year-old Team Quest representative.

Report: Darren Till Arrested for Drunk Driving in Stockholm

UFC middleweight Darren Till was arrested in Stockholm on charges of drunk driving last month, according to Swedish news outlet Expressen.

Till was pulled over on July 31 while driving at high speeds behind the wheel of a silver Audi with English plates. According to police, Till was “noticeably drunk.” The fighter admitted to having “one to two beers” at a restaurant but initially claimed that the woman he was with was driving the vehicle. Till later admitted to driving while intoxicated and according to a police report said the incident would ruin his career.

The Liverpool native ultimately submitted to a breath test for alcohol, which came back three times above the legal limit and accepted a penalty order, the terms of which are currently unknown.

Flyweights Alex Perez, Amir Albazi to Clash at UFC Event on Dec. 17

A flyweight showdown pitting Alex Perez against Amir Albazi is on tap for an Ultimate Fighting Championship event on Dec. 17.

Perez confirmed the booking on social media following an initial report from MMAFighting.com. The UFC Fight Night event doesn’t yet have an official location or main event.

After winning six of his first seven Octagon appearances, Perez has dropped back-to-back fights in the Las Vegas-based promotion. The Team Oyama representative was submitted by Deiveson Figueiredo in a flyweight title bout at UFC 255 before tapping to a first-round neck crank from Alexandre Pantoja in his last outing at UFC 277.

Albazi, meanwhile, has emerged as an interesting prospect at 125 pounds after besting Malcolm Gordon, Zhalgas Zhumagulov and Francisco Figueiredo in his first three UFC bouts. The 28-year-old London Shootfighters product owns a 15-1 professional mark overall.

‘Russian Ronda’ Irina Alekseeva Signs Contract with UFC

Irina Alekseeva, a flyweight known as “Russian Ronda,” has signed with the Ultimate Fighting Championship.

Suckerpunch Entertainment, which represents Alekseeva, announced the news on Tuesday. A date for Alekseeva’s promotional debut is currently unknown, but she is not expected to compete on Dana White’s Contender Series before stepping into the Octagon.

Alekseeva previously appeared at Bellator 269, where she defeated Stephanie Ielo Page via unanimous decision in October 2021. She has since been released by the California-based promotion. She owns a 4-1 career mark overall, with two triumphs coming inside the distance.

The 32-year-old has won multiple championships in combat sambo and is a three-time silver medalist at the Russian Judo Championships.

Bellator 289 to Feature Bantamweight Grand Prix Semifinals on Dec. 9

The semifinals of the Bellator bantamweight grand prix have a date and venue.

Promotion officials announced Monday that Bellator 289 will be topped a pair of 135-pound pairings from the bracket, as interim champ Raufeon Stots meets Danny Sabatello, while Patricky Mix takes on Magomed Magomedov. Bellator 289 takes place on Dec. 9 at Mohegan Sun Arena in Uncasville, Conn., and airs on Showtime at 9 p.m. ET/6 p.m. PT.

A two-time NCAA Division II wrestler from the University of Nebraska at Kearney, Stots is 6-0 in Bellator competition. He claimed interim 135-pound gold with a third-round KO of Juan Archuleta in the opening round of the grand prix at Bellator 279.

Sabatello, who wrestled at Purdue University, is 3-0 under the Bellator banner and 13-1 as a professional overall. The former Titan FC title holder punched his ticket to the bantamweight semifinals with a five-round verdict over Leandro Higo at Bellator 282 on June 24.

Nemkov vs. Anderson 2, Freire vs. Nurmagomedov Set for Bellator 288 on Nov. 18

A pair of title fights will top the card for Bellator 288 on Nov. 18.

The California-based promotion announced Monday that a light heavyweight championship rematch between Vadim Nemkov and Corey Anderson will headline the card, while a previously reported lightweight title tilt pitting Patricky Freire against Usman Nurmagomedov will serve as the co-main event. Bellator 288 takes place at Wintrust Arena in Chicago, and the main card airs on Showtime at 9 p.m. ET/6 p.m. PT.

Nemkov and Anderson initially squared off in the finals of the 205-pound grand prix at Bellator 277, but the bout was declared a no contest due to an accidental clash of heads 4:55 into Round 3. Prior to the foul, Anderson appeared to be imposing his will through wrestling in Rounds 2 and 3 after a solid opening stanza from Nemkov.

Contender Series Weigh-in Results: All Week 6 Competitors Cleared

All 10 athletes slated to compete on Week 6 of Dana White’s Contender Series made weight without issue on Monday.

The Contender Series takes place at the UFC Apex in Las Vegas on Tuesday night and airs on ESPN+ at 8 p.m. The evening’s featured bout is a welterweight clash pitting Yusaku Kinoshita (171) against Jose Henrique Souza (171).

A native of Osaka, Japan, Kinoshita has been victorious in five of his first six professional outings — with his lone defeat coming as a result of disqualification due to fence grabbing. He has finished all of his opposition inside of a round while competing in the Deep and Pancrase promotions.

Brazil’s Souza is 5-0 thus far in his burgeoning MMA career. The Nova Uniao MPBJJ product last competed at LFA 132, where he defeated Pedro Oliveira via split decision on May 13. His other four triumphs have come via knockout or technical knockout.
